Atomium is a monument of Brussels, in Belgium, builds on the occasion of the World Fair of 1958 and representing the conventional stitch of the iron crystal (cubic phase centered) enlarged 165 billion times. Atomium was imagined by the engineer André Waterkeyn and set up by the architects André and Jean Polak for the World Fair of 1958 in Brussels. It is a building halfway between the sculpture and the architecture that peaks in 102 m. Its structural steel weighs 2 400 tons. It became, in the same way as Manneken Pis and Grand Place, a symbol of the capital of Belgium.
